MOT Testing in Durham
There are 53 DVSA-authorised MOT test centres in Durham.
The maximum MOT fee for cars (Class 4) is £54.85. Test centres can charge less than the maximum. 5 centres also offer motorcycle MOTs (Class 1 & 2). 22 centres can test larger vans and commercial vehicles (Class 7).
You can book your MOT up to one month minus a day before it expires without losing the existing renewal date.

How to Choose an MOT Centre in Durham
1. Match the vehicle class
Cars normally need Class 4. Motorcycles require Class 1 or 2, while heavier goods vehicles may need Class 7. Use the filters above before calling.
2. Ask about price and retests
Confirm the current test price, what happens if the vehicle fails, whether repairs are offered and which partial-retest rules apply.
3. Confirm before travelling
Check opening hours, appointment availability and that the centre still tests your vehicle class. Directory details can change.
